+1(514) 937-9445 or Toll-free (Canada & US) +1 (888) 947-9445

nc100

Hero Member
Apr 29, 2017
295
32
Hi,

Has anyone recently submitted there passports in the London visa office?

Can you please help me with the timeline of how long does it take to get the passports back.

Thanks